ASSOCIATION FOOTBALL.

MANAGEMENT MATTERS. SATURDAY'S REP. FIXTURE. The Management Committee of the A.F.A. met last night, Mr. Andrew Menzies presiding. The medical superintendent of the Auckland Mental Hospital thanked the A.F.A. for thoughtfulnes'S in sending complimentary tickets for the North ShorePorlrua cup tie. The action of the A.F.A., It was stated, was the means of helping to brighten the lot of some of the inmates. The committee decided to extend an open invitation to Dr. Prins and any patients and attendants he considered would .benefit from an outing to visit Blandford Park when suitable. Arrangements were finalised for the rep. match, Navy v. .Auckland, on .Saturday. The New Zealand Council wrote regretting that it was impossible to arrange for the Otago Boys' High School to play Mount Albert Grammar School for the Skerrett Cup as a curtain-raiser to the Chatham Cup final. The council expressed its interest in school football, and assured the A.F.A. and the Junior Management of their readiness to help along the game in the school grades. The question of a fixture for the injured ■players' day was discussed. It was agreed that October 2 be set aside for this object, the principal attraction being a match between Tramways (Auckland champions) and North Shore (North Island champions). The matter of arranging a curtainraiser in the shape of a comody game was left to Mr. Reason to confer with the navy teams and report next week. JUNIOR MANAGEMENT. The Junior Management Committee met last night, Mr. F. M. Kitchie presiding. It was decided to declare the fifth grade A competition closed. North Shore, being in an unassailable position, were declared winners. Mr. l'\ M. Ritchie donated a set of medals to. the winners of the fifth grade X competition, and was cordially thanked for his gift. It was .agreed that the final of the fourth grade knock-out between V.M.C.A. and North Shore be played on Saturday. A Rules Committee of Messrs Harrison, Hodge, Ballantyne, Ritchie and Beswick was appointed to formulate rules for school and junior grade competition's. Messrs. Beswick and Ballantyne were appointed selectors of the under 15 rep. team to meet the primary school reps, on a date to be fixed. SATURDAY'S FIXTURES.
